Your journey starts now—protect and innovate with MANTECH!MANTECH seeks a motivated, career and customer-oriented Draftsman to join our engineering team in Crane, IN. This is an onsite position.In this role, you will help our engineering team translate complex concepts into precise technical drawings and models. As a vital member of the design process, you will support the development of Technical Data Packages (TDPs) for mechanical and mission systems, ensuring every design meets stringent military standards and is optimized for the full equipment lifecycle.Responsibilities include but are not limited to:Create high-fidelity 3D models and detailed 2D engineering drawings using SolidWorks while ensuring compliance with ASME Y14.5 (GD&T) standards and managing version controlSupport the development of comprehensive Technical Data Packages (TDPs), including assembly, sub-assembly, and detailed part drawings for military applicationsCollaborate closely with Mechanical and Systems Engineers to refine designs based on analysis and testing results, ensuring CAD models include all necessary metadataInterface with manufacturing teams to ensure all designs are optimized for production through DFM/DFA principlesGenerate and maintain accurate Bills of Materials (BOMs) within the CAD environment and assist in the preparation of Engineering Change Notices (ECNs) and Proposals (ECPs)Ensure all documentation adheres to specific Department of Defense (DoD) formatting and security marking requirementsPerform critical quality assurance through self-checks, peer reviews, and providing dimensional data for First Article Inspection (FAI) processesMinimum Qualifications:Associates degree in Drafting/Design, Mechanical Technology, or a related field; or equivalent vocational training and experience3+ years of professional experience as a Draftsman or CAD DesignerProficiency in SolidWorks, including 3D modeling, large assembly management, and 2D draftingExperience developing drawings for military applications and adhering to MIL-STD-31000 requirementsPreferred Qualifications:SolidWorks Professional (CSWP) or Expert (CSWE) certificationExperience with SolidWorks PDM (Product Data Management) for file versioning and workflow managementExperience drafting for electronic packaging, cable harnesses, or structural airframe modificationsKnowledge of additive manufacturing (3D printing) design requirementsClearance Requirements:Must be able to obtain and maintain a DoD Secret clearancePhysical Requirements:Must be able to remain in a stationary position 50%Needs to occasionally move about inside the office to access file cabinets, office machinery, etc.Frequently communicates with co-workers, management, and customers, which may involve delivering presentations.Must be able to exchange accurate information in these situationsMANTECH considers all qualified applicants for employment without regard to disability or veteran status or any other status protected under any federal, state, or local law or regulation.
